Introduction

The course focuses on strategic areas of management. Successful organizations, whether large or small, are well managed.  The development of management skills within an organization is an essential part of continued business growth. The programme is meant to meet the current need for mangers with broad based training, who are at the same time specialists in a given area of business. The programme incorporates Information Technology to help meet the demands of the current demands of business world. This programme has been designed to deepen and broaden the students’ practical knowledge and skills in business management in preparation for the labour market, self employment as well as for further studies at related at degree level.

Aims and Objectives

This programme aims to achieve the following objectives:
1.To develop an understanding of the general issues and approaches to business and management
2.To enhance self-confidence and the ability to critically evaluate business and develop solutions from moral, professional and the academic perspectives
3.To instill a problem solving attitude and business ethics in the practice of management.
4.To prepare the candidates for progression to degree levels

ENTRY REQUIREMENTS
SASS- 2
A candidate must satisfy any of the following minimum requirements for entry in Certificate programme:
either
1.Be holders of aggregate grade of C- in KCSE and grade C- in Mathematics and English.
Or
2.Division III in KCE with credit passes in mathematics and English
Or
3.Be a holder of any other qualification accepted by the University Senate as equivalent to any of the above
A candidate must satisfy any of the following minimum requirements for entry in Diploma programme:
either
4.Be a holder of aggregate grade of C in KCSE and grade C- in Mathematics and English.
Or
5.Be a holder of KACE certificate with a Division III in KCE with credit passes in mathematics and English
Or
6.Be holder of holder of an accredited certificate with a credit pass that is recognized by the University Senate
Or
7.Be a holder of any other qualification accepted by the University Senate as equivalent to any of the above
